I had exactly the same case a few days ago and I think the cause is thermal throttling. Lagging opponent car (they keep skipping forward and backwards very fast during driving) and slowdown effect appeared when my phenom 1045T reached 72 degrees of Celsius. There was a lot of dust on the heat sink and fan. After removal of this I had a temperature of about 52 degrees, and everything was fine.
